This week, John Talman and Luke Hansen sit down with Dmitriy Ivanchuk, founder of HeyPros and Homze, to unpack his remarkable journey from an immigrant family steeped in trades work to becoming a tech innovator reshaping labor management in construction. From launching his first painting business at 18 to designing algorithms that help even greenhorns quote like seasoned pros, Dmitriy explains how creativity, marketing savvy, and relentless problem-solving led to the birth of HeyPros and Homze.
